Total synthesis of psammaplysenes A and B, naturally occurring inhibitors of FOXO1a nuclear export.

Savvas N Georgiades1, Jon Clardy.   

Abstract

[reaction: see text] Two inhibitors of FOXO1a-mediated nuclear export, psammaplysenes A and B, have been synthesized by a flexible and efficient route. A common starting material, 4-iodophenol, was used to prepare both halves of these pseudosymmetric dibromotyrosine-derived metabolites.
